The Kremlin in 2014 stated a draft peace agreement that Russia and Ukraine discussed in Istanbul early in the problem– yet which Kyiv denied– might be the basis for talks.
It required Ukraine’s nonpartisanship, specified NATO refute it subscription, placed restrictions on Kyiv’s militaries and postponed talks on the standing of 4 Russian-occupied areas that Moscow later on linked unlawfully. Moscow likewise rejected demands to withdraw its troops, pay payment to Ukraine and encounter a global tribunal for its activity.
Putin hasn’t suggested he will certainly move yet stated “if there is a need to bargain and discover a concession option, allow anybody carry out these arrangements.”
” Involvement is not the like settlement,” stated Sir Laurie Bristow, British ambassador to Russia from 2016-20, defining Russia’s technique as “what’s mine is mine. And what’s your own is up for settlement.”
Bondarev likewise stated Putin sees arrangements just as a car “to supply him whatever he desires,” including it’s “unbelievable” that Western leaders still do not comprehend Kremlin methods.
That suggests Putin is most likely to invite any kind of conference with Trump, because it advertises Russia as an international pressure and plays well locally, yet he will certainly use little in return.

Trump has actually endangered Russia with much more tolls, assents and oil cost cuts, yet there is no financial “marvel tool” that can finish the battle, stated Richard Connolly, a Russian armed forces and economist at London’s Royal United Solutions Institute.
And the Kremlin is cleaning off the risks, likely since the West currently has actually greatly approved Russia.
Trump likewise can not ensure Ukraine would certainly never ever sign up with NATO, neither can he raise all Western assents, conveniently pressure Europe to return to importing Russian power or obtain the International Wrongdoer Court to retract its battle criminal offenses apprehension warrant for Putin.
Talking To the Davos World Economic Forum, Trump stated he desires the OPEC+ partnership and Saudi Arabia to reduce oil rates to press Putin to finish the battle. The Kremlin stated that will not function since the battle has to do with Russian protection, not the cost of oil. It likewise would certainly damage united state oil manufacturers.
” In the tradeoff in between Putin and residential oil manufacturers, I’m rather certain which option Trump will certainly make,” stated Alexandra Prokopenko, an other at the Carnegie Russia Eurasia Facility in Berlin.
Trump might press Russia by propping up the united state oil market with aids and raise the 10% profession tolls troubled China for Beijing restricting financial connections with Moscow, which might leave it “really separated,” Connolly stated.
